Victims of Violent Crime Compensation
Financial assistance for certain crime-related expenses is available to some victims of violent crime through the Victim of Violent Crime Compensation and Assistance Division of the Attorney General’s Office. This program is funded by the federal Victims of Crime Act (VOCA) and the state. Eligible victims and their families can receive compensation for medical, dental and mental health counseling expenses, funeral and burial expenses, lost wages resulting from crime-related injuries and the loss of financial support for the dependents of homicide victims.
